Output e07faf81fef25d83039bb276855fa1b5c55f8593a55732256c110e84f0a58f88: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e9309453dbcae94f5f7593121a42128b9c2c623 OP_EQUALVERIFY OP_CHECKSIG
address
12L4bwZq42qPZCtoetEuWvuWBqznjHNe7q
transaction
e07faf81fef25d83039bb276855fa1b5c55f8593a55732256c110e84f0a58f88
spent
true